2011-10-15
mac Django1.3 fastcgiでtwtter検索を作るチュートリアル
pythonも触ったことがなかったのですが、
最近Djangoの引き継ぎをしなくてはならなくなったので
課題としてtwitterの検索(DBつかわない)を作ったのでそれのメモです。
公式のチュートリアルサイトを参考にしました。
https://docs.djangoproject.com/en/1.3/intro/tutorial01/
2011-08-29
lessコマンド
裏のシステムとかでよく使うようになったless.
基本コマンド
#ダブルバイト表示 -r #エディタの起動 v #tail -f と同じような動きをする(ログ見るときに便利) F #1行上、下へ動く j,k #1ページ上、下へ N,B
markつけた部分をパイプで外部コマンドに投げる。
less でファイルをながめてて、ここだけコピーしたいなど
#markをつける #mを押すと名前を聞かれるので設定する。 m<markの名前> #次に|を入力すると、どのmarkからやるのかきかれ、コマンドを聞かれます |<markの名前> #markを入れた後、コマンドを入力します。(markされた場所をcatで表示してtext.txtに書き込んでる) ! cat > test.txt
screen のセッションに名前を付ける。
screen -S connvoi #もしくはscreen アタッチ中に sessionname connvoi
こうすると、
screen -r connvoi
とかいう指定ができて楽。
2011-05-25
iMovie'11をつかってテロップ入りの動画を作る方法
結婚式で使ったヒストリーDVDとか、2次会でアレしたやつとか、
最近やたらと使いことが多かったiMovie。
実はクロマキー合成ができたり、けっこうできるかわいいやつだったので、
青の洞窟のまとめ動画を作りながらまとめます
2011-03-30
電力使用状況API
YJDNから電力使用状況APIがでました。
Yahoo!デベロッパーネットワーク - 震災関連情報 - 電力使用状況API
というわけで、magiさんにつぶやいてもらおうと思います。
2011-02-02
2011-01-05
MacBookAir & HTC Aria を買いました。
ちょっと前に、MacBookAirと、HTC Ariaをかいました。
今年はこいつらを駆ってモバイル生活しようかなと。
1ヶ月弱使ってみた感触です。
2010-12-20
PaginatorHelperでの複雑なURL指定(CakePHP Advent Calender 20日目)
CakePHP Advent Calender 2010の20番手として、
id:kunitさんControllerからModelを使用するいくつかの方法 (CakePHP Advent Calendar 19日目)からバトンを引き継ぎましたー。
今日は少し前に調べたPaginatorHelperについて、自分の備忘録として書いておこうかと思います。
PaginatorHelperでの複雑なURL指定
検索結果のPaginationはすべてのURLのどこかに検索クエリを引き継ぐ必要があります。
例えば、controller内のpaginateにcondisitonsを追加して、DBからlike句の検索結果を引きます。
/* *app/controllers/test_controller.php */ $this->paginate(array("comment"=>'LIKE %検索クエリ%'));
こういったときに、Paginatorをそのまま使うと
/* *app/views/test/index.php */ echo $paginator->numbers(array('modules'=>4)); /*出力されるURL*/ ROOT/test/index/page:1 ROOT/test/index/page:2 .... ROOT/test/index/page:5
になってしまい、次のページ以降で何で検索されてるのかがわからなくなってしまいます。
結果から言うと、イカのようにPaginatorのオプションのurlに設定してあげるとうまく行きます。
/* *app/views/test/index.php */ echo $paginator->numbers(array( 'modules'=>4, 'url'=>array('?'=>'q=検索クエリ') )); /*出力されるURL*/ ROOT/test/index/page:1?q=検索クエリ ROOT/test/index/page:2?q=検索クエリ .... ROOT/test/index/page:5?q=検索クエリ
で、それをどうやって探したかを書いていきます。












